Output aa188a59fbe7165c98ae18bf3071b7e804a1c142ffb930045deb7c4b77bb4625:5

value
786162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c63a5bf32551e7f6c2965c8a213f910a024e4af6 OP_EQUAL
address
3Km9dPkLm349WGouaNDzgzV7dAYQDQSxYx
transaction
aa188a59fbe7165c98ae18bf3071b7e804a1c142ffb930045deb7c4b77bb4625
spent
true